Job Summary

The Admissions Coordinator is responsible for efficiently managing the intake process for clients seeking admission to the facility. This involves conducting initial screenings, verifying benefits, determining eligibility, scheduling admissions, and completing intakes. As a primary point of contact, the coordinator guides prospective clients, family members, legal entities, and referral sources through the intake process, providing information about the programs and services offered. The role requires strong communication skills, empathy, and the ability to work collaboratively with individuals in recovery and a multidisciplinary team of professionals.

Key Responsibilities
  • Handling Inquiries:
  • Receive and process inbound inquiries and referrals from phone, web inquiries/chat, Alumni phone app referrals, fax, email, and Teams chat.

Managing the Intake Process:

  • Assess potential clients' treatment needs.
  • Complete preadmission screenings.
  • Determine eligibility based on ASAM criteria.
  • Verify benefits.
  • Schedule admissions or assist with referrals to higher levels of care as needed.

Documentation:

  • Collect required documentation such as medical records, identification, and insurance information.
  • Maintain accurate and complete CRM and Electronic Medical records, including assessments, consent forms, releases, and other documentation in accordance with confidentiality regulations.

Financial Communication:

  • Determine and communicate necessary finances due upon admission.

Relationship Management:

  • Maintain positive relationships with potential patients, family members, referents, and other community members.

Teamwork:

  • Support the admissions team in tracking bed availability and ensuring timely placement for qualified individuals.
  • Follow up with daily scheduled admissions and intakes.
  • Excel in teamwork, working in unison with all staff to ensure a positive client experience.

Customer Service:

  • Provide compassionate, empathetic, knowledgeable customer service to a wide variety of people calling into the Admissions Center.

KPI Accountability:

  • Review and be accountable for monthly departmental and individual KPIs, including:
  • Turnaround time from first contact to admission.
  • Conversion rate of inquiries to admissions.
  • Average daily census.
  • Number of admissions.
  • Contact quality of handling calls.
  • Average speed of answer.
  • Client satisfaction survey scores.
  • Completed documentation.
  • Completed BAM-R assessments on admission.
